Transaction d91ea5af0a1ecb2b58096d010e95de6b102682f84d120961d3f84ca95fb442e9

250 Input
2 Outputs
  • d91ea5af0a1ecb2b58096d010e95de6b102682f84d120961d3f84ca95fb442e9:0
  • value  20000000000
    address  1A5PFH8NdhLy1raKXKxFoqUgMAPUaqivqp
  • d91ea5af0a1ecb2b58096d010e95de6b102682f84d120961d3f84ca95fb442e9:1
  • value  323269228880
    address  bc1q8z3tnkvh4s0mjmrrt4gyptakq77m66lqmmrqtw